You can definitely use it through ebay ... but I believe you can also go directly to paypal.com. If you just go to paypal.com, it will take you through the steps of setting up an account. You will need to link it to either a bank account or a credit card. Then, whenever you make payments through Paypal, it will come directly out of whatever form of payment you designated. It's just like setting up an account to use for online purchases. You can also use it on other websites as well when purchasing items (only if they accept it obviously). It's great because you don't have to put in your account information everytime you buy something ... you just have to enter your login information.
It works pretty easily. Although some ebayers will not accept it. I saw on 20/20 or Dateline or one of those that some people have reported problems with it. I use it and have not yet had any problems. They work with international accounts too ... but not everywhere. It will tell you if your area is not within its region. Good luck! |

The problems most people have had have been linked to emails sent by hackers/imposters. If ebay/paypal sends you an email (as with any other email), never enter any private information on a "reply." Always go to the site itself and check out the situation. I got one that looked like that from ebay and went to ebay, and sure enough, it was an imposter.
But you can hook up to paypal if you have a credit card or bank account. I have done it for quite a while and had no problems.
